Walrus Protocol: The New Standard for Web3’s "Heavy" Data Layer 🦭
As we move further into 2026, the bottleneck for decentralized applications (dApps) is no longer just transaction speed—it's data density. While modern blockchains like Sui handle thousands of transactions per second, storing the actual content of those transactions (4K video, AI training models, and high-fidelity gaming assets) remains prohibitively expensive. This is where @walrusprotocol enters the chat. What is Walrus Protocol? Walrus is a decentralized storage and data availability network designed specifically for "blobs"—large, unstructured binary files. Developed by the pioneers at Mysten Labs, it serves as the high-capacity hard drive for the Sui ecosystem and beyond. Unlike traditional decentralized storage that can be sluggish or costly, Walrus is built for high-performance, real-time access. The Secret Sauce: "Red Stuff" Encoding The technical breakthrough of Walrus lies in its proprietary 2D erasure coding algorithm, Red Stuff. * High Resilience: Even if up to two-thirds of the storage nodes go offline, your data remains fully recoverable. * Low Overhead: Traditional networks often require 10x replication to ensure safety. Walrus achieves better durability with only a ~4-5x replication factor, making it significantly cheaper. * Cost Efficiency: In 2026, Walrus has maintained its edge as one of the most cost-effective layers in the industry, often beating traditional decentralized rivals by 80% or more in storage fees. The Power of $WAL The native token, $WAL , is the economic engine of the protocol. It isn't just a speculative asset; it's a utility powerhouse: * Storage Payments: Users pay in WAL to secure storage space for a specific duration. * Network Security: Storage nodes must stake $WAL to participate. Incompetent or malicious nodes face slashing, ensuring the integrity of the "blobs." * Governance: Token holders help shape the parameters of the storage market, including pricing and protocol upgrades. Why It Matters for 2026 With the rise of AI-driven dApps and Decentralized Social (DeSo), the need for a storage layer that "acts like a cloud but thinks like a blockchain" is critical. Walrus allows smart contracts to treat massive data files as native objects. This means a game can delete an old asset, or an AI model can update its weights directly through a smart contract—realizing the dream of truly programmable storage.
